Introduction
Workbenches form the backbone of any workshop, garage, or home office. Choosing the right bench influences productivity, safety, and comfort. This article compares five popular Amazon listings: OLBRUS 48" Workbench, WORX Pegasus Folding Workbench, WEN 48" Workbench, CAMMOO 48" Adjustable Workbench, and CAMMOO 60" Adjustable Workbench. By analysing price, features, ratings, and real‑world performance, readers can decide which bench aligns with their specific needs.
Individual Product Overviews
OLBRUS 48" Workbench
Price: $139.99 | Rating: 4.5/5 (466 reviews) | Availability: In Stock
- Adjustable non‑slip rubber foot pads for uneven floors.
- Six height levels ranging from 26.3" to 35.8".
- Integrated power strip with four AC outlets and two USB‑A ports (ETL certified).
- Rubber wood tabletop, steel legs, 2000 lb load capacity.
- 48" × 24" work surface.
Customer feedback highlights easy assembly, industrial aesthetic, and the usefulness of the built‑in power strip. One reviewer noted, "The outlets are sweet" and praised the stability of the rubber feet.
WORX Pegasus Folding Workbench
Price: $119.99 | Rating: 4.8/5 (14,309 reviews) | Availability: In Stock
- Portable 2‑in‑1 design: functions as a table (300 lb capacity) and a sawhorse (1000 lb capacity).
- Folds to a 30 lb package that fits under the arm.
- Integrated clamping system: two 24" quick clamps (301 lb force) and four clamp dogs.
- Built‑in measuring guide.
- ABS plastic with steel supports; expandable by linking multiple units.
Reviewers love its lightweight nature and versatility. One user wrote, "Extremely durable and very well built!" and praised the ease of storage in small garages.
WEN 48" Workbench
Price: $150.70 | Rating: 4.1/5 (2,901 reviews) | Availability: In Stock
- 62" tall, 48" × 25" footprint, 47" × 23" tabletop supporting 220 lb.
- Three 13‑amp 120 V outlets and an overhead fluorescent light.
- Pegboard, two drawers, and a bottom shelf (200 lb capacity).
- Enamel‑coated tabletop, two‑year warranty.
Positive comments emphasize sturdy construction and ample storage, while some note a lengthy assembly process. A reviewer stated, "The assembly was a nightmare though," yet still rated the bench highly for value.
CAMMOO 48" Adjustable Workbench
Price: $109.99 | Rating: 4.4/5 (49 reviews) | Availability: In Stock
- Solid rubber wood top (48" × 24") with steel frame, 2000 lb capacity.
- Tool‑free six‑position height adjustment (28"‑39").
- ETL‑certified power strip: four AC outlets, two USB ports, master switch.
- Adjustable non‑slip leveling feet.
- Single‑person assembly.
Customers appreciate the robust build and easy setup. One user remarked, "Very nice work bench sturdy easy to put together," and highlighted the extra parts included.
CAMMOO 60" Adjustable Workbench
Price: $149.99 | Rating: 4.8/5 (649 reviews) | Availability: In Stock
- 48" × 60" rubber wood tabletop, 2000 lb capacity.
- Six height settings (28.5"‑39") with tool‑free knobs.
- Dual‑side pegboards, six tool‑holding hooks.
- ETL‑certified power strip with four AC outlets, two USB ports, and a 6.5 ft cord.
- Easy single‑person assembly.
Reviewers love the extra length for larger projects. One comment reads, "The tops are smooth and provide a nice surface area for my work," and the seller’s responsive customer service is repeatedly praised.
Head-to-Head Comparison
Price and Value
The CAMMOO 48" Adjustable Workbench offers the lowest price at $109.99 while still delivering a 2000 lb capacity and integrated power strip. The WORX Pegasus is the most affordable at $119.99, but its load capacity is lower (300 lb table, 1000 lb sawhorse). The OLBRUS 48" Workbench sits at $139.99, providing a generous 2000 lb capacity and a larger surface. The WEN 48" Workbench costs $150.70 and adds built‑in lighting and storage, but its load rating is only 220 lb. The CAMMOO 60" Adjustable Workbench is $149.99, delivering extra length for a modest price increase.
Features and Specifications
All benches except the WORX Pegasus include integrated power strips. The OLBRUS and both CAMMOO models provide four AC outlets and two USB ports, all ETL certified. Height adjustment ranges differ: OLBRUS (26.3"‑35.8"), CAMMOO 48" (28"‑39"), CAMMOO 60" (28.5"‑39"), and WORX (fixed 32" height). The WEN bench lacks height adjustment but offers a pegboard, drawers, and a fluorescent light. The Pegasus stands out with its 2‑in‑1 table/sawhorse function and built‑in clamps, which none of the other models provide.
Customer Ratings and Feedback
Ratings vary from 4.1 to 4.8 stars. The WORX Pegasus leads with 4.8/5 based on over 14,000 reviews, indicating broad satisfaction, especially regarding portability. The CAMMOO 60" also scores high (4.8) with fewer reviews, highlighting strong performance for its price. The OLBRUS and CAMMOO 48" benches hold solid 4.5 and 4.4 ratings, respectively, while the WEN bench trails at 4.1, reflecting mixed feelings about assembly difficulty.
Performance and Reliability
Load capacity is a key reliability metric. Both the OLBRUS and CAMMOO benches claim 2000 lb capacity, suitable for heavy drill presses or multiple tools. The WEN bench supports only 220 lb on the top, limiting it to lighter tasks. The Pegasus, despite a lower table capacity (300 lb), compensates with a 1000 lb sawhorse rating and robust clamping force (301 lb). Customer anecdotes confirm that the OLBRUS and CAMMOO benches remain stable under heavy equipment, while the WEN bench’s lighter construction is praised for everyday hobby use.

FAQ
- Do these workbenches require tools for assembly? The OLBRUS and both CAMMOO models need basic wrenches or Allen keys for bolts, while the WORX Pegasus arrives mostly pre‑assembled. The WEN bench has the most screws and benefits from a screwdriver set.
- Can I use a drill press on the OLBRUS bench? Yes; the bench is rated for 2000 lb and reviewers confirm stable operation with heavy drill presses.
- Is the power strip on the CAMMOO benches safe? Both CAMMOO models feature ETL‑certified strips, meeting North American safety standards.
- How much weight can the WORX Pegasus support as a table? The table portion supports up to 300 lb, while the sawhorse configuration can hold up to 1000 lb.
- What is the warranty on these benches? The WEN bench includes a two‑year warranty. Other brands typically offer limited manufacturer warranties, but exact terms were not listed in the product data.
- Can I expand the work surface of the WORX Pegasus? Yes; additional Pegasus, Sidekick, or Clamping Sawhorse units can be linked to create a longer surface.
- Are the rubber feet on the OLBRUS bench adjustable? Absolutely; each leg has an adjustable rubber foot pad for leveling on uneven floors.
